Ingredients

30 mins
4 servings
  1. 9 ozextra firm tofu
  2. 3 ozpork belly or bacon
  3. 4leek stems
  4. 4large Shiitake mushrooms
  5. 2 tspvegetable oil
  6. Sauce
  7. 1 cupchicken stock
  8. 1 tbspsoy sauce
  9. 1 tbsprice wine
  10. 1/2 tspspicy bean paste
  11. 1/2 tbspsesame oil

Cooking Instructions

30 mins
  1. 1

    Chop the mushrooms into chunks

  2. 2

    Cut the leek stems into 1"long pieces

  3. 3

    Slice the pork belly into thin, bite-sized pieces.

  4. 4

    Cut tofu into slices about 1/2" to 3/4" thick, then cut into 1" cubes.

  5. 5

    Add oil to a wok and brown tofu slightly on a low to medium heat. Remove to a plate when done.

  6. 6

    Fry pork in the wok with a little oil at a medium heat until fragrant and slightly crisp. Remove to your tofu plate.

  7. 7

    Mix the sauce and boil in the wok.

  8. 8

    Add leeks, mushrooms, tofu, and pork belly to wok and stir. Serve when hot.
